Restrictions are:
1. Self Contained only
2. Duration of stay no more than 4 consecutive nights in any one calendar month.
So, as long as you meet the above conditions , not a problem to camp there.

DOC Campsite CategoryWhat category does this Department of Conservation (DOC) campsite fall into? DOC Restricted Freedom Camping Site Department of Conservation Restricted Freedom Camping Sites are for Self Contained Vehicles only with restrictions over length of stay. Some of these locations may have a toilet, but this can't be expected. |
